Now, let me answer the question. There are SOME tickets put on sale for each game the day of the game, about 1000 standing room tickets and SOME seats, depending on how many are claimed from employees and players and how many are returned from the Cubs’ quasi-legal ticket scalping operation.

About a month ago they changed the procedure for buying these tickets — you now have to go in right after buying them, which helps get them out of the hands of street scalpers.

Also

These tickets go on sale 3 hours before the game, when the doors open. They no longer go on sale when the box office opens at 8AM.

From my experience

when I went about two weeks ago, it was a 12:05 start and I got to the line at 8:50am and hardly anyone was there. They didn’t end up selling the tickets until around 9:20am or so and there were no bleacher tickets available, but otherwise a pretty good selection. At that point the line was pretty long. I would assume the later the start time, the more likely the line will be long when they start selling.

Once I bought the tickets, I had to go sit in a waiting area until the doors opened at 10am.
